Senior Software Engineer- Big Data & Java at PointClickCare

This role is ideal for a Senior Software Engineer with a deep background in big data ecosystems and Java/Python development. You should be an expert in distribu

Work type: remote

Location: Remote, USA

Salary: $158,000 – $176,000/yr

Type: Full-time

This role is ideal for a Senior Software Engineer with a deep background in big data ecosystems and Java/Python development. You should be an expert in distributed computing and storage, comfortable managing massive datasets within a health-tech context. The team is looking for a self-starter who practices Test-Driven Development (TDD) and thrives in high-scale, distributed environments. The position offers a competitive salary range of $158k–$176k and the autonomy of a fully remote setup (distributed across the US). While remote, you’ll still benefit from high-touch culture moments through occasional travel for team summits. PointClickCare is a stable, privately held leader in healthcare SaaS, emphasizing R&D reinvestment and a modern "AI-first" workflow where tools like GitHub Copilot are encouraged. **You might be a good fit if you:** * Have hands-on experience with Apache Hudi, Trino, Spark, or Databricks. * Are proficient in writing clean, scalable code in Java and have experience building RESTful APIs. * Live and breathe TDD and have a solid grasp of distributed storage (S3, ADLS, or HDFS). * Are comfortable with infrastructure-adjacent tech like Docker, Kubernetes, and CI/CD pipelines.

View this job on nocollar jobs